The under-eye area often shows signs of aging and fatigue earlier than other parts of the face. Dark circles, puffiness, and hollowing can create a tired or stressed appearance, even when you feel well-rested. Because the skin beneath the eyes is thinner and more delicate, changes happen quickly and are often more noticeable.

Why the Under Eye Area Is So Vulnerable

Skin beneath the eyes is thinner than anywhere else on the face. It contains fewer oil glands and less structural support, which makes it more prone to showing changes related to circulation, fluid retention, and volume loss.

Blood vessels are closer to the surface, fat pads are smaller, and collagen decreases more quickly. These factors explain why discoloration, swelling, and hollows develop even in younger adults.

What Causes Dark Circles Under the Eyes

Dark circles are one of the most common under-eye concerns. Their appearance varies depending on the underlying cause.

Thin Skin and Visible Blood Vessels

As skin thins, underlying blood vessels become more visible, creating a bluish or purplish tone. This is common with aging and genetics.

Hyperpigmentation

Excess melanin can darken the under-eye area, especially in individuals with deeper skin tones. Sun exposure and inflammation often contribute to this type of discoloration.

Fatigue and Poor Circulation

Lack of sleep may slow circulation, causing blood to pool beneath the eyes. This can make the area appear darker and dull.

Allergies and Sinus Congestion

Allergic reactions increase blood flow and swelling in the under-eye region. Frequent rubbing can worsen pigmentation over time.

Genetics

Some individuals naturally have darker pigmentation or deeper tear troughs that create shadowing beneath the eyes.

What Causes Under-Eye Puffiness and Bags

Puffiness occurs when fluid or fat accumulates beneath the eyes. Several factors may contribute.

Fluid Retention

Salt intake, dehydration, hormonal changes, and sleeping position can cause fluid to collect under the eyes, especially in the morning.

Aging and Fat Prolapse

With age, the muscles supporting the under-eye area weaken. Fat pads that once provided smooth contours may shift forward, creating under-eye bags.

Allergies and Inflammation

Inflammation increases swelling and contributes to persistent puffiness, particularly during seasonal allergy flare-ups.

Lifestyle Factors

Smoking, alcohol consumption, and chronic stress can impair circulation and lymphatic drainage, leading to swelling.

What Causes Under-Eye Hollowness

Hollowness refers to a sunken appearance beneath the eyes, often called tear troughs. This concern tends to become more noticeable with age.

Volume Loss

Natural loss of fat and collagen reduces structural support under the eyes. This creates shadows that make the area appear sunken.

Bone Structure Changes

Facial bones gradually lose density over time, altering support for surrounding tissues.

Weight Fluctuations

Significant weight loss can reduce facial fat, including in the under-eye area.

Genetics

Some individuals naturally have deeper tear troughs, even at a young age.

Why Multiple Under-Eye Concerns Often Appear Together

Dark circles, puffiness, and hollowness often coexist. Volume loss can create shadows that deepen dark circles. Puffiness above a hollow area can exaggerate contrast. Addressing one concern without considering the others may lead to incomplete results.

A comprehensive evaluation looks at skin quality, volume, circulation, and lifestyle factors together.

How Lifestyle Influences Under-Eye Appearance

Daily habits play a major role in under-eye health.

  • Inadequate sleep
  • Dehydration
  • Excessive salt intake
  • Sun exposure without protection
  • Smoking
  • Chronic stress

Improving these habits supports better treatment outcomes and longer-lasting results.

Professional Assessment Makes the Difference

Because under-eye concerns have multiple causes, professional evaluation is essential. A trained provider can determine whether discoloration is pigment-based or vascular, whether puffiness is fluid-related or structural, and whether hollowness is contributing to shadowing.

This assessment guides treatment selection and prevents overcorrection in a sensitive area.

Treatment Options for Under-Eye Concerns

Modern aesthetic care offers targeted solutions based on the underlying cause.

Medical Grade Skincare

Specialized products support pigment control, hydration, and barrier strength.

Energy-Based Treatments

Laser and light-based treatments may reduce discoloration and improve skin texture.

Injectable Treatments

Fillers can restore lost volume and smooth hollow areas when appropriate.

Skin Tightening Treatments

Non-surgical options may improve firmness and reduce fine lines.

Combining approaches often provides the most natural and balanced results.

Preventing Future Under-Eye Changes

Prevention supports long-term results.

  • Daily sun protection
  • Gentle skincare routines
  • Adequate hydration
  • Allergy management
  • Regular professional evaluations

These steps help preserve skin quality and slow the progression of under-eye aging.
